ACTION REQUESTED: Approval or reject the following motion: ALLOW CONSTRUCTION ACTIVITIES OUTSIDE OF THE HOURS OF 7 AM AND 6 PM WITH CONDITIONS, AS DESCRIBED IN ATTACHMENT 1, FOR CONSTRUCTION OF I-5/BELTLINE INTERCHANGE UNIT 3. ISSUE STATEMENT: Section 5.220(c) of the Springfield Municipal Code allows construction activities between 7 am and 6 pm. In order to complete project work in a timely manner, and to reduce the project’s impact on traffic, the Oregon Department of Transportation (ODOT) proposes to perform much of this project during nighttime hours from November 1, 2012 through November 30, 2014. ATTACHMENTS: 1: Noise Variance Request from ODOT DISCUSSION/ FINANCIAL IMPACT: ODOT is engaged in a multi-unit/multi-year project to improve traffic capacity and safety at the I-5/Beltline Interchange. Units 1 and 2 of the project are complete, and construction on Unit 3 is scheduled to begin in November 2012. Unit 4 is currently under design with construction anticipated to begin in 2014. Unit 3 involves reconstructing the Beltline Overcrossing over I-5, and the south bound off ramps from I-5 to Beltline. It will also include reconfiguring part of the southwest corner of the Beltline/Gateway Intersection that was constructed with Unit 2 to accommodate new eastbound lane configurations on Beltline. ODOT will pay all costs associated with the Unit 3 project. Attachment 1 includes a detailed description of the work, potential noise generating activities, and ODOT’s plans for managing nighttime work and lane closures throughout the 2-year construction term. A Springfield staff member will be involved in the construction team and will communicate anticipated night work to Council, staff and the public. Staff recommends approval of the requested night work for I-5/Beltline Interchange Unit 3 as proposed in Attachment 1.
